McLaren throw down challenge to Norris for 2022

McLaren executive racing director Andrea Stella has backed Lando Norris as "one of the strongest drivers" in F1 whilst challenging the Briton to up his consistency levels in 2022.

Norris was one of the standout performers in 2021, scoring four podiums across the season and amassing 160 points to end the year sixth in the drivers' standings.

Such was the pace of the 22-year-old he was in contention to finish third behind only title rivals Max Verstappen and Lewis Hamilton until a late power unit upgrade pushed Ferrari ahead of McLaren in terms of outright pace.

Speaking in a media briefing, including GPFans, in Abu Dhabi, Stella explained: "I think Lando, in his third year of Formula 1, has developed in terms of, first of all, pure speed.

“I am confident to say that in terms of pure speed, he is one of the strongest drivers on the grid and I think this is true in all conditions.

"It is enough to think some of the performances in the wet and also the pole position he scored in Russia was in transitional Tarmac conditions. In Q3 we shifted from intermediate to soft compound [tyres]."

Although impressed with Norris' progression, with the Briton's points total 63 greater than in 2020, Stella confirmed there remains room for improvement.

“With Lando, we also worked on improving the racecraft, so the capacity to score points, and I think this is in a way proven by the facts [results]," added Stella.

“Where I see the opportunity with Lando is on consolidating these very high standards that he has achieved in every single session, so we want more consistency of deploying this level of top performance."
